Abstract
In this paper an efficient penta-band microstrip-fed slot antenna with a compact size of 38×19 mm2 is presented for wireless applications. Each band can be controlled in a wide range by variation of only one dimension parameter whereas other bands remain unchanged. Variation ranges are from 2.3 to 2.62 GHz for f1, 4.25 to 4.76 GHz for f2, 5.7 to 6.35 GHz for f3, 6.72 to 7.35 GHz for f4 and 7.55 to 8.35 GHz for f5. Also a measured bandwidth of 130 MHz (%5.3 at 2.47 GHz) is achieved for the first resonance.
